Hi
I have been using Abyss for well over a year now, upgraded to X2 after my testing and have never looked back. I host several virtual sites on my server, but am adding a Wordpress install for the first time. The Wordpress install has to sit in a virtual host. I downloaded and installed the pre-configured MySQL (4.1), PHP 5, and PHPMyAdmin. I followed the instructions for PHPMyAdmin and everything is working. I can access the MySQL through PHPMyAdmin so I know all is good there. I then created a new host (and an associated directory for it) and made sure PHP scripts are enabled for it. I then copied wordpress into this new directory. I changed the wordpress config file to reflect the proper MySQL settings. However, when I begin the install of Wordpress I get to the first page (name of blog and email address) I then click INSTALL and I am constantly getting an Error 404 - Not Found message for 'step-2'. I am not certain what I am doing wrong. Any assistance would be appreciated.

I have a similar problem. Wordpress installed but when I try to access it from my network or through the internet it loads with all writing on left side and no theme. If I access from the computer abyss is installed on it loads fine. |

Sounds like the path is set incorrectly. The path for the styling must not be a local address. Make sure it's a correct HTTP URL. Check the HTML source code for the page in question. _________________ Stephen
